Profiling refers to the development of analysis, based on specific groups of data that are entered in the database and maintained by the Trade Union Advisory Committee to the OECD (TUAC) as background information for all countries and selected regions, industrial sectors and specific companies.
These data are then broken down and made available in many report forms to facilitate analysis on given topics. However, the production of Profiles has been standardised and some are available on an ongoing basis for specific topics: Sustainable Development, Energy and Climate Change, Occupational Health and Safety, Asbestos, HIV/AIDS, Trade Union Rights, as well as Corporate Accountability.
